What caused the downward trend in crude oil price?
Weekly crude oil price, that showed an upward trend up until March, 2021, has suddenly turned downward, when 3-point-moving averages are taken into account. This is not something that analysts anticipated, especially when there are clear signs of global demands going up. Moreover, in the US, there were strong indications of an economic recovery in proportion to the scale of the vaccine rollout. The increase in the crude oil output by the OPEC+, despite done under global political pressure, also signalled optimism on the part of the cartel that the demand would finally be on the rise. In addition, in China, the world’s second largest consumer, the economy shows a steady growth and the crude oil demand is going to go up at a faster rate in the coming months. The reliable positive news on multiple fronts clearly eclipsed the negative sentiment that stemmed from the upsurge of new Coronavirus infections in Europe and Asia.
